Mukesh Choudhary Playing MI vs CSK Match for THIS Reason Despite Losing His Mother

3 min
Mukesh Choudhary

The two five-time champions, Mumbai Indians and Chennai Super Kings, are facing each other in the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2026 at the iconic Wankhede Stadium. However, the contest carried an emotional backdrop for CSK, as the team paid tribute to pacer Mukesh Choudhary’s mother, who passed away earlier this week.

The CSK were seen wearing black armbands during the match against Mumbai Indians as a mark of respect. The news of his mother’s demise came just days before the high-profile encounter, making it a deeply personal moment for the CSK camp.

Mukesh Choudhary Playing Despite Personal loss

Despite the tragic loss, Mukesh Choudhary showed immense courage by continuing to stay involved with the team during this difficult period. The left-arm quick is also a part of the CSK playing XI in what is usually called the Indian El Clasico. The MI vs CSK IPL 2026 clash is very important for Chennai as they have won only two out of seven matches in the tournament and are at the bottom half of the IPL points table.

Since Chennai Super Kings doesn't have many pace-bowling options available due to injuries, Choudhary set aside his personal loss and played for his team. The reports confirm that his mother had been battling illness for a long time before passing away, and the franchise has extended full support to the player and his family.

Mukesh Choudhary MI vs CSK presence shows his immense courage and dedication for the game. There have been many cricketers who have suffered personal loss during big tournaments. The current situation won't be easy for him but he has shown great attitude towards the game. The youngster will be key for his team, especially with the new ball. It remains to be seen how he performs after this tragic loss.

Important Season for Mukesh Choudhary

It is just the second game of the season for Mukesh Choudhary. He picked up two wickets in the previous match against Sunrisers Hyderabad. Both the wickets were big ones as he dismissed Travis Head and Ishan Kishan, two of the most dangerous batsmen in IPL.

Choudhary came into the Playing 11 in place of Khaleel Ahmed, who has been ruled out due to injury. Chennai Super Kings have been suffering several injury concerns this series, which have clearly affected their performance as well.
